MONASTERIO DE PIEDRA Located in the Nuévalos area, near Calatayud , The Monasterio de Piedra is an ideal place to spend a great day out with children. The monastery’s nature park offers an enjoyable walk of about two and a half hours through a lush and unusual garden where the sound of the water in the waterfalls, caves and lakes guides you through the dream-like surroundings. Along the way, children can visit the fish farm and feed the trout or visit the exhibition on the history of chocolate, which was made for the first time in the monastery’s kitchen. And from March to October, you can also enjoy a spectacular display of birds of prey in flight.

ZARAGOZAAMUSEMENT PARK This is a city park, just a few minutes from the centre of Zaragoza , with more than 60,000 m2 of fun and enter- tainment in the midst of the pine trees of Los Pinares de Venecia . More than 40 rides and a wide range of catering services make the Zaragoza Amusement Park a special place. If you go by car, there are several free parking areas next to the park, but you can also get there on one of the city’s buses. An unmissable day out for all the family during your visit to Zaragoza.
